Expense Comparison: Leasing Vs. Owning

When reviewing the financial implications of possessing versus leasing building and construction equipment, a complete cost comparison is important for making notified decisions. The selection between possessing and leasing can significantly influence a firm's profits, and comprehending the linked prices is crucial.

Leasing building equipment typically includes lower upfront expenses, allowing services to designate capital to other functional demands. Rental agreements usually consist of versatile terms, enabling companies to access advanced equipment without long-lasting commitments. This adaptability can be particularly advantageous for temporary projects or changing work. However, rental expenses can collect over time, possibly going beyond the expenditure of possession if tools is needed for a prolonged duration.

Conversely, having building and construction equipment needs a substantial first investment, together with recurring expenses such as financing, insurance coverage, and devaluation. While ownership can result in lasting savings, it additionally binds resources and may not give the same level of adaptability as renting. Additionally, having equipment necessitates a dedication to its usage, which might not constantly straighten with project demands.

Ultimately, the choice to own or rent out should be based upon a detailed evaluation of particular job needs, economic ability, and lasting tactical goals.

Maintenance Responsibilities and costs

The selection in between renting and owning construction devices not just involves economic factors to consider however additionally includes ongoing upkeep costs and obligations. Owning tools requires a considerable commitment to its maintenance, that includes routine examinations, repair work, and potential upgrades. These duties can promptly collect, leading to unexpected costs that can strain a budget plan.

On the other hand, when renting out equipment, upkeep is commonly the obligation of the rental firm. This arrangement permits service providers to avoid the economic worry connected with wear and tear, along with the logistical challenges of scheduling repairs. Rental contracts often include arrangements for maintenance, meaning that contractors can focus on completing tasks as opposed to fretting concerning tools problem.

Depreciation Effect On Ownership


A considerable factor to think about in the choice to own construction devices is the influence of devaluation on overall ownership prices. Devaluation represents the decline in worth of the tools with time, affected by aspects such as usage, wear and tear, and innovations in technology. As equipment ages, its market price lessens, which can dramatically affect the proprietor's monetary setting when it comes time to trade the equipment or offer.




For building firms, this devaluation can convert to substantial losses if the tools is not used to its fullest potential or if it becomes outdated. Proprietors should represent devaluation in their economic forecasts, which can result in higher general costs compared to leasing. In addition, the tax obligation ramifications of depreciation can be complicated; while it may give some tax obligation advantages, these are frequently balanced out by the reality of reduced resale value.

Monetary Flexibility of Leasing

Renting construction devices offers substantial monetary adaptability, enabling business to allocate sources a lot more efficiently. This versatility is especially essential in a sector characterized by rising and fall job demands and differing workloads. By choosing to rent out, organizations can prevent the significant capital outlay required for buying equipment, maintaining cash flow for other functional needs.

Furthermore, renting out equipment enables firms to customize their equipment selections to particular task needs without the long-term commitment related to possession. This means that services can easily scale their devices stock up or down based on anticipated and present project demands. As a result, this adaptability reduces the danger of over-investment in equipment that might become underutilized or outdated gradually.

Another financial advantage of leasing is the capacity for tax benefits. Long-Term Job Considerations

When reviewing the lasting requirements of a construction service, the choice in between possessing and leasing tools comes to be much more complicated. Secret elements to consider include task duration, frequency of use, and the nature of upcoming tasks. For projects with extended timelines, purchasing tools might seem helpful because of the potential for link reduced overall costs. Nevertheless, if the devices will certainly not be used consistently across projects, owning may cause underutilization and unneeded expense on storage space, insurance, and maintenance.


Furthermore, technological improvements present a significant consideration. The building sector is evolving rapidly, with brand-new devices offering boosted performance and security features. Renting out permits firms to access the latest technology without committing to the high upfront prices related to acquiring. This versatility is especially beneficial for organizations that deal with varied jobs calling for various kinds of equipment.

Moreover, financial stability plays an essential function. Owning tools usually requires significant capital expense and devaluation issues, while leasing enables even more predictable budgeting and capital. Eventually, the choice in between owning and leasing must be aligned with the strategic objectives of the building company, thinking about both expected and present job needs.
